在当今的计算机系统中,驱动签名是一种安全机制,确保所有安装的硬件驱动程序都来自可信的发行者,并且未被篡改。通常,这要求驱动程序必须由微软数字签名,以确保它们符合特定的硬件和安全标准。然而,在某些情况下,开发者或用户可能需要安装未签名或自签名的驱动程序,例如在调试新硬件或开发过程中。在这样的情况下,就产生了“无需禁用驱动签名,给驱动添加签名”的需求,以合法地安装和测试这些驱动程序,而不需要关闭操作系统的驱动程序签名强制功能。 为了实现这一点,可以使用一些工具和方法来为驱动程序添加签名,这样它们就可以在启用了驱动程序签名强制的系统上运行。以下是一些常用的方法和步骤: 1. 使用第三方工具:市面上存在一些第三方工具,这些工具能够为驱动程序文件(通常是SYS文件)添加微软签名。这些工具通过特定的算法和代码,模仿微软的签名过程,从而生成一个有效的签名。这些工具的操作简便,只需选择要签名的驱动文件并执行相应的签名操作即可。 2. 使用命令行工具:微软提供了一个名为“signtool”的命令行工具,该工具是Windows SDK的一部分。它允许开发者直接在命令行环境中对文件进行签名。通过正确配置并使用signtool,可以为驱动程序文件创建一个兼容的签名,然后使用它来安装驱动。 3. 利用证书:要使用signtool或某些第三方工具,需要有一个有效的代码签名证书。这些证书可以向受信任的证书颁发机构(CA)购买。有了证书后,就可以用它来签署驱动程序,创建一个安全的、经过认证的驱动程序安装包。 4. 操作系统级别的设置:虽然本指南是关于如何在不禁用驱动签名的情况下安装驱动,但值得注意的是,可以通过修改本地组策略或使用注册表编辑器在操作系统级别上暂时禁用驱动签名强制。这一步骤涉及到更改系统配置,使得即使是未签名的驱动也可以安装。然而,这种方法并不推荐用于长期使用,因为关闭驱动签名强制会降低系统的安全性。 5. 正确的安装步骤:在为驱动程序添加了签名之后,正常的安装步骤包括将驱动文件放置到适当的目录,运行安装程序或通过设备管理器安装。在安装过程中,系统会验证签名,并允许安装如果签名有效。 6. 测试和验证:安装驱动后,应该在测试环境中运行并进行充分的测试,以确保驱动程序的稳定性和安全性。必须确保驱动程序没有引入任何安全漏洞,并且不会导致系统不稳定。 需要强调的是,虽然这些工具和技术可以在不关闭驱动签名强制的情况下安装驱动,但这并不意味着可以随意安装任何驱动程序。添加签名只是绕过签名强制的一种技术手段,并不意味着该驱动程序已经过微软的审核。因此,只应该在确实需要时,例如测试新硬件或开发自定义驱动程序时,才使用这种方法,并且始终确保使用的驱动程序来源可靠且安全。 为驱动添加签名的方法虽然提供了一定的便利,但考虑到操作系统的安全要求和潜在风险,开发者和用户必须谨慎行事,确保不会因为绕过安全机制而引入安全漏洞或恶意软件。对于那些必须在安全环境中运行的系统,如服务器或关键业务系统,始终建议遵守最高安全标准,避免使用未签名的驱动程序。
2026-01-17 10:13:10 3.2MB 驱动签名
1
一键禁用启用网络脚本批处理,win10亲测可用,如果针对不同网卡,则把以太网改成对应网卡的名字就行,如在win7 ,需要改成本地连接
2026-01-15 22:21:44 268B 禁用网卡 启用网卡
1
window 10 永久暂停更新更新任务计划的时候发生错误需要用到PsTool, 下载地址为:PsTools下载地址:https://learn.microsoft.com/zh-cn/sysinternals/downloads/pstools 在处理Windows 10系统更新任务计划错误时,若需要永久禁用自动更新功能,可以利用PsTools这一工具套件中的PsExec工具来实现。PsExec是一个小型且强大的命令行实用程序,它允许用户通过网络在远程或本地Windows系统上执行进程。通过PsExec的特定参数,管理员能够停止更新服务,从而实现对更新任务的暂停或永久禁用。 要使用PsExec永久禁用Windows 10自动更新,首先需要下载PsTools工具包。PsTools是微软官方提供的一个系统管理工具集,包含了多个实用工具,PsExec正是其中的一个。PsTools可以从微软官方网站下载,确保下载的工具安全可靠,不带有恶意软件或病毒。下载完毕后,解压缩得到PSTools文件夹,里面包含了PsExec工具以及其他系统管理工具。 在使用PsExec之前,需要确保系统上安装了PsTools工具集,然后通过命令提示符运行特定命令。具体操作如下: 1. 打开命令提示符(以管理员身份运行),输入如下命令: ``` psexec -i -d -s wuauserv ``` 该命令的各参数含义如下: - `-i`:表示以交互式的方式运行指定的程序。 - `-d`:表示程序运行后不等待,立即关闭。 - `-s`:表示以系统权限运行指定的程序。 - `wuauserv`:是Windows Update服务的名称。 执行该命令后,Windows Update服务将被停止,从而实现对自动更新的禁用。但需要注意的是,这种禁用并非永久性,如果系统重启或手动重新启动Windows Update服务,更新功能将会再次启用。若要实现永久禁用,还需在注册表中进行设置,阻止Windows Update服务自启动。 然而,在考虑永久禁用Windows 10自动更新之前,应仔细考虑其潜在的安全风险。自动更新是Windows系统重要的安全机制之一,能够及时修补系统漏洞,防止恶意软件攻击。若用户对系统安全性要求不高,且希望长期保持系统稳定,才可考虑使用此类方法暂停或禁用更新。否则,建议用户定期检查并安装更新,保持系统安全性。 对于需要在企业环境中统一管理多台计算机的更新策略的IT管理员,使用组策略或者管理工具来控制更新,通常是更为安全和合适的方式。这些方法可以集中管理、调度更新计划,并且能保证在需要时能够及时部署更新。 虽然PsExec工具可以实现对Windows 10更新任务的控制,但操作复杂,且可能带来安全风险。用户在采取此类措施前应充分考虑其必要性,并在必要时寻求专业人士的帮助。对于希望保持系统最新状态的用户,建议不要禁用更新功能,或使用更为安全的管理策略来维护系统的安全更新。
2026-01-13 07:44:38 4.91MB window10 禁用自动更新
1
在Delphi编程环境中,开发人员经常需要处理操作系统底层的任务,如网络接口的管理。这个压缩包文件"Delphi检测网卡并将其禁用和启用的源代码.."包含了用于实现这一功能的源代码,这对于系统管理员工具或者网络监控软件的开发来说是极其有用的。 Delphi是一种基于Object Pascal的强大的Windows应用程序开发工具,它提供了丰富的组件库和强大的IDE(集成开发环境),使得编写底层系统级代码变得相对简单。在这个项目中,开发者可能使用了Windows API函数来获取系统中的网络适配器信息,例如通过`SetupDiGetClassDevs`函数获取设备列表,然后通过`SetupDiEnumDeviceInfo`遍历网卡设备。 禁用和启用网卡的操作通常涉及到调用`DeviceIoControl`函数,这个函数可以向设备发送控制代码,从而改变设备的状态。对于网络适配器,我们可以使用IOCTL_NDIS_QUERY_GLOBAL_STATS控制代码来获取设备状态,然后通过IOCTL_NDIS_SET_GLOBAL_STATS来更改它。这些操作需要对NDIS(网络驱动接口规范)有一定的理解,因为NDIS是Windows操作系统中管理和通信网络适配器的核心接口。 在代码实现过程中,可能还使用了以下关键步骤: 1. 初始化设备信息集:使用`SetupDiGetClassDevs`函数获取所有网络适配器的设备信息集。 2. 遍历设备:使用`SetupDiEnumDeviceInfo`循环遍历设备信息集中的每个设备。 3. 获取设备详细信息:使用`SetupDiGetDeviceRegistryProperty`获取设备的相关属性,如设备名称、硬件ID等。 4. 打开设备句柄:通过`CreateFile`函数打开设备,准备进行设备控制操作。 5. 发送控制代码:使用`DeviceIoControl`函数,通过适当的控制代码禁用或启用网卡。 6. 错误处理:确保每个API调用都进行错误检查,以便在出现问题时能正确处理。 为了保证代码的可读性和可维护性,开发者可能采用了面向对象的设计原则,将相关的操作封装到类中,如`TNetworkAdapter`,包含方法如`Disable`和`Enable`,这样在实际项目中可以更方便地管理和操作网卡。 此外,源代码可能还包括了用户界面元素,如按钮或菜单项,允许用户触发禁用和启用网络适配器的操作。这些界面元素会连接到相应的事件处理函数,调用上述类的方法来执行实际的系统操作。 这个Delphi项目提供了一个实用的例子,展示了如何利用Delphi和Windows API来管理网络适配器的状态。这不仅有助于学习Delphi编程,也有助于深入理解底层系统操作的原理。对于想要扩展其Delphi技能的开发者来说,这是一个很好的学习资源。
2026-01-12 09:49:05 20KB Delphi
1
codesys从站禁用功能块及说明.zip
2025-12-13 10:05:17 898KB
1
在IT行业中,Delphi是一种基于Pascal语言的集成开发环境(IDE),用于创建Windows桌面应用程序。这个标题"delphi禁用USB源代码"涉及到的是如何使用Delphi编程来实现对USB设备的控制,特别是禁用USB接口的功能。这在一些特定场景下非常有用,比如企业数据安全、防止非法数据拷贝等。 描述中提到,这段源代码是一个宝贵的资源,对于那些需要进行USB接口管理的开发者来说是很有价值的分享。通过这段代码,开发者可以学习到如何在Delphi程序中操作系统底层,与硬件接口进行交互,从而实现对USB设备的禁用。 在Delphi中,要禁用USB接口,主要涉及Windows API调用。Windows API提供了丰富的函数和结构体,用于管理和控制系统的硬件设备,包括USB设备。开发者需要了解如`SetupDiGetClassDevs`这样的函数,它用于获取所有符合特定设备类的设备实例。然后,可以使用`SetupDiEnumDeviceInterfaces`枚举USB设备接口,并通过`SetupDiOpenDeviceInterface`打开设备接口。 接下来,关键的步骤是禁用USB设备。这通常涉及到修改设备的配置或者注册表设置。例如,可以调用`DeviceIoControl`函数,向设备发送特定的控制命令,比如`IOCTL_USB_HUB_CLEAR_PORT_FEATURE`来移除端口功能,从而达到禁用USB设备的目的。同时,可能还需要处理设备驱动程序和服务,比如停止或卸载相关的服务,以确保设备无法被识别和使用。 此外,为了使程序更完善,通常还需要编写相应的错误处理机制,确保在设备操作失败时能正确地反馈信息。同时,考虑到用户界面,可能需要设计一个友好的图形界面,让用户可以方便地启用或禁用USB设备。 至于压缩包中的"del62236883",很可能是源代码文件的名字。在解压后,开发者可以查看这个文件,深入理解代码的实现逻辑,学习如何在实际项目中应用类似的功能。 这段Delphi源代码提供了一个关于系统级设备控制的示例,对于提升Delphi开发者在系统编程和硬件交互方面的技能大有裨益。通过分析和学习,开发者不仅可以掌握USB设备的禁用方法,还能增进对Windows API和系统级编程的理解。
2025-10-13 11:21:29 178KB delphi USB
1
USB设备的禁用启用的批处理,可以很好的控制USB存储。
2025-09-15 15:41:33 580B USB禁用启用
1
工作环境需要用代理上网,而家里上网不需要代理。 每次背着本本回到家要打开IE将代理禁用,第二天一早来到公司又要打开IE启用代理,尽管几步就可以完成,可是懒人的我要说:No!所以写了这个小工具。省了不少事儿。 操作很简单,打开文件后,如果Enable Proxy按钮为可用状态,说明您当前的IE代理为禁用状态;如果Disable Proxy按钮为可用状态,则表明您当前的IE设置为可用状态。点击相应的按钮可以启用/禁用IE代理。 当然,在这之前需要您在IE里设置过代理。简要概述如下:工具->Internet选项->链接->局域网设置->代理服务器....
2025-09-06 01:09:22 4KB 启用IE代理 快捷切换 懒人必备
1
摆动鼠标 摆动鼠标以防止屏幕保护程序的简短实用程序(当缺乏管理员访问权限以禁用屏幕保护程序时) 用法 双击wiggle_mouse.exe启动。 关闭控制台或按 Ctrl-C 停止。 您可以将可执行文件复制并粘贴到您想要的任何位置,或者为其创建任意快捷方式。 确保将配置文件连同它一起复制! 如果程序找不到配置文件,它会自动生成一个新的。 源代码仅供参考——它实际上并没有做任何事情。 元数据 联系方式: 下载: :
2025-08-29 15:27:52 14KB
1
标题 "禁用360流氓软件" 暗示了我们讨论的主题是关于如何处理360安全卫士,这是一款在中国广泛使用的安全软件,但有时可能会被用户视为"流氓软件",因为它的某些行为可能被视为过于侵入或干扰用户系统。在某些情况下,用户可能想要禁用或卸载它,以获得更顺畅的电脑使用体验。 我们需要理解“360安全卫士”是什么。360安全卫士是一款集成了多种安全和系统维护功能的软件,包括病毒查杀、木马防护、系统清理和优化等。虽然它旨在保护用户的电脑安全,但其自动更新、弹窗广告和未经用户同意的自启动等功能可能会被用户视为不便。 禁用360安全卫士的步骤通常包括以下几个方面: 1. **关闭360服务**:在Windows的“服务”管理工具中,可以找到并停止360相关的后台服务,如360卫士服务、360云安全服务等。这样可以防止360软件在后台运行。 2. **禁用启动项**:在任务管理器的“启动”选项卡中,可以禁用360相关的启动项,阻止它随系统启动。 3. **修改注册表**:这通常需要谨慎操作,因为错误的修改可能导致系统问题。文件名为“禁用360.reg”的文件可能包含了一组注册表键值,用于禁用360的某些功能或阻止其运行。导入这个注册表文件前,务必备份原有的注册表,以防万一。 4. **卸载360安全卫士**:如果彻底禁用的需求,可以通过控制面板的“程序和功能”进行卸载。但请注意,这将移除所有360相关的保护和服务,建议在卸载后寻找其他可靠的替代安全软件。 5. **阻止软件自安装**:有时360会与其他软件捆绑安装,需要在安装其他程序时仔细检查选项,避免自动安装360。 6. **使用第三方工具**:市面上也有一些第三方工具可以帮助禁用或卸载360,但使用这些工具需谨慎,确保来源可靠。 禁用360安全卫士是为了减少它对电脑性能的影响或避免其行为与用户的期望不符。然而,这也意味着失去了它提供的安全防护,因此在做出决定之前,用户应权衡安全与便利之间的关系,并考虑使用其他安全解决方案来填补可能的安全空缺。同时,保持良好的网络习惯,如不随意下载不明来源的文件,定期更新操作系统和软件,也是保障电脑安全的重要措施。
2025-08-13 18:49:45 4KB 禁用360
1